Meet Rani ❤️
* Toward People: Very affectionate, constantly reaching out to the family to be petted! She takes a while to warm up, when she gets to know someone. When she does, though, she will come over with a wagging tail, kiss them, and sit next to them when they call her name.😆
* Toward Dogs: Got along well with other dogs at the Center! Does not seem really interested in other dogs, but when she does see them frequently, she resorts to and plays nicely with them. Exibits no sign of hostility but may show signs of unease when approached suddenly or by larger dogs.
* Toward Cats: Does not show much interest in cats and gets along well with them.
* Separation Anxiety: Not at all. Enjoys her own time.
*Potty Training: 100% prefers outdoor potty.
* Hygiene: Loves being brushed and maintains composure when brushed repeatedly. While giving her a bath and using a dryer, everything is peaceful. Is learning how to be tooth-brushed.
* Walks: Fearful of cars, warning alarm, and noises of children. Short walks in quiet places is what she is currently practicing, and she follows well once acclimated. A double leash is necessary as she might startle and pull on the leash.
* Feerful of being harnessed. Requires to wear the leash gradually in order to be comfortable.
* Car sickness: No motion sickness but panting occasionally. She can get inside the vehicle by herself with no problem.
💌Special Note💌
* She is frightened by sudden touches or approaches, loud noises, and abrupt hugs.
* When terrified or overly excited, she may have piss accidents.
* In elevators, she quietly sits in a corner and waits when someone enters.
* She is easy to get up and down from elevated places.
* Avoids making contact with anything on the desk.
* She knows her meal times precisely and even gives a morning call for them 🤣
